gh-95011: Migrate syslog module to Argument Clinic#95012
Conversation
|
Most changes to Python require a NEWS entry. Please add it using the blurb_it web app or the blurb command-line tool. |
Sorry, something went wrong.
3496e2d to
6c6648e
Compare
July 19, 2022 19:46
6c6648e to
6e2cc36
Compare
July 20, 2022 05:43
|
Also, please don't force push; it does not play well with the GitHub UI. Please use |
Sorry, something went wrong.
Sorry, something went wrong.
serhiy-storchaka
left a comment
There was a problem hiding this comment.
Looking at the code I found several issues in syslog (#95041). Please wait until I fix them.
Sorry, something went wrong.
|
A Python core developer has requested some changes be made to your pull request before we can consider merging it. If you could please address their requests along with any other requests in other reviews from core developers that would be appreciated. Once you have made the requested changes, please leave a comment on this pull request containing the phrase |
Sorry, something went wrong.
Co-authored-by: Erlend Egeberg Aasland <erlend.aasland@protonmail.com>
Co-authored-by: Erlend Egeberg Aasland <erlend.aasland@protonmail.com>
|
I have made the requested changes; please review again. |
Sorry, something went wrong.
|
Thanks for making the requested changes! @erlend-aasland: please review the changes made to this pull request. |
Sorry, something went wrong.
|
It looks like Serhiy's comments were addressed. I'm going to land this later today. |
Sorry, something went wrong.
|
Wait a bit more. I think that the new tests are worth to be backported, so I added them to my branch which adds other tests. I worked on this on Saturday, but I need a few more days to let it mature. |
Sorry, something went wrong.
|
Ok, thanks for the heads-up. I'll mark this as don't-merge in the meantime. |
Sorry, something went wrong.
@serhiy-storchaka: do you have an issue/PR number for this, so we can track progress? |
Sorry, something went wrong.
7115de2 to
0e0d9c6
Compare
September 7, 2022 21:47
☝🏻 |
Sorry, something went wrong.
|
Sorry for the delay. See #97953. After merging it I'll merge this PR. |
Sorry, something went wrong.
* main: Minor edits to the Descriptor HowTo Guide (pythonGH-24901) Fix link to Lifecycle of a Pull Request in CONTRIBUTING (python#98102) pythonGH-94597: deprecate `SafeChildWatcher`, `FastChildWatcher` and `MultiLoopChildWatcher` child watchers (python#98089) Auto-cancel old builds when new commit pushed to branch (python#98009) pythongh-95011: Migrate syslog module to Argument Clinic (pythonGH-95012)
* main: (5519 commits) Minor edits to the Descriptor HowTo Guide (pythonGH-24901) Fix link to Lifecycle of a Pull Request in CONTRIBUTING (python#98102) pythonGH-94597: deprecate `SafeChildWatcher`, `FastChildWatcher` and `MultiLoopChildWatcher` child watchers (python#98089) Auto-cancel old builds when new commit pushed to branch (python#98009) pythongh-95011: Migrate syslog module to Argument Clinic (pythonGH-95012) pythongh-68686: Retire eptag ptag scripts (python#98064) pythongh-97922: Run the GC only on eval breaker (python#97920) GitHub Workflows security hardening (python#96492) Add `@ezio-melotti` as codeowner for `.github/`. (python#98079) pythongh-97913 Docs: Add walrus operator to the index (python#97921) [doc] Fix broken links to C extensions accelerating stdlib modules (python#96914) pythongh-97822: Fix http.server documentation reference to test() function (python#98027) pythongh-91052: Add PyDict_Unwatch for unwatching a dictionary (python#98055) pythonGH-98023: Change default child watcher to PidfdChildWatcher on supported systems (python#98024) pythonGH-94182: Run the PidfdChildWatcher on the running loop (python#94184) pythongh-92886: make test_ast pass with -O (assertions off) (pythonGH-98058) pythongh-92886: make test_coroutines pass with -O (assertions off) (pythonGH-98060) pythongh-57179: Add note on symlinks for os.walk (python#94799) pythongh-94808: Fix regex on exotic platforms (python#98036) pythongh-90085: Remove vestigial -t and -c timeit options (python#94941) ...

This improves code readability and performance by delegating all of the argument parsing logic to Clinic.
Fixes #95011